Check out the Lacoste Spring Summer 2022 collection

Louise Trotter's continuing interest in sports and culture informs her dynamic approach to Lacoste as a genuine cornerstone of French sportswear. The spirit of mobility, lightness, and utility is fundamental in her design approach, which draws inspiration from the world of tennis - the brand's very lifeblood – to cycling, basketball, and other city sports. The Lacoste Spring Summer 2022 collection blurs the barriers between performance and aesthetics for a simplified approach to summer in the city by examining the confluence of athletic outfits with our everyday life.

When it comes to the personality of athletes, essential silhouettes show surface innovation and contrasting features heightened with a technological polish, from René Lacoste and his tennis partner, Suzanne Lenglen's elegant portraits in the Roaring Twenties to Peter Sutherland and Philippe Bialobos' rhythmic documentation of urban bike couriers in the 2000s, a call-and-response of sartorial and sporting tropes results in hybrid typologies and subtle nods to sporting subcultures. The shorts suits are made of neoprene piqué jersey, the pleated tennis skirts are made of frosted pastel rubber, and the Lacoste polo is reinvented in the printed mesh.

A new color study alters the perspective of classic sports references, emphasizing warm, brilliant tones of red, emerald, burgundy, orange, and acid yellow against the classic Lacoste palette of Lacoste green, navy, taupe, black, and optic white. Mesh logo paneling and vented inserts are used to explore garment aeration and ventilation throughout cycling vests, track shorts, and basketball tanks, while ergonomic perforations are laser-carved by hand into neoprene varsity jackets. Engineered knits are next in line, with fully-fashioned striped rib skirts and matching sets joining fresh variations of the trademark patchwork tennis sweater. Soft parachute nylons and gloss textures highlight games of transparency, combining with ghost-stitched embossed rubber outerwear and framis-zipped elastic anoraks for a sense of urgency and quickness.

Offbeat accessories, such as molded pool slides and jacquard knee socks, enhance the season's urban look, as do tinted shield sunglasses on neoprene straps, flask holders, and strapped crossbody messenger bags. Along with modular digital wristwatches, pastel carabiner keyrings, tennis visors, and the flat-brimmed 5-panel 'Girolle' cap in neoprene jersey, cutout trainers are traced with bungee cord lacing, emphasizing the young attitude.
